## Introduce per-tenant rate quotas in the Orvane gateway

For the release manager: this change replaces our global throttle with per-tenant quotas, resolved at request time from the tenant registry and cached for sixty seconds. Tenants without an explicit quota inherit the tier default; overage returns a retryable status with a hint header. Rollout is gated behind a flag, defaulting off, and the old throttle remains as a backstop until two clean release cycles pass.

The initial tier defaults we intend to ship are listed below.

limits module of taguf-hafog:
WEIGHTS = {
    "wenox": 690,
    "wenok": 782,
    "kelax": 41,
    "holox": 338,
    "quenir": 39,
}

## Releases

PortionWise releases ship every Thursday after the sync. Tag the commit, run the scale-regression suite, and build the tarball with make dist. Releases are cut from main only; hotfixes get cherry-picked. All artifacts must be verified before upload, so sign the tarball using the key below.

release key, kawif-hawep: bky13_X7TGuRG4Zu4ZJ

## Step 4: Enable the circuit breaker

Before routing traffic through the new Kellerman upstream adapter, enable the breaker in Fallowmesh. Without it, upstream timeouts cascade into the queue workers, as seen in last month's incident.

Deploy the adapter, then flip the breaker flag in staging first. Verify trip/recover behaviour via the dashboard.

Apply the following breaker configuration.

service settings:
[silwyn]
host = silwyn.crelvogrid.internal
user = silwyn_svc
database = silwyn_prod

Subject: Image cache leak — fix landing before Thursday's sync

Hey all — quick update for the weekly sync. The slow memory creep in the Fernvale thumbnail cache turned out to be evicted entries keeping their decode buffers alive via a stale listener. Priya's fix drops the listener on eviction and adds a heap gauge so we catch this earlier next time. Soak test on canary looks flat after 36 hours. The candidate build is identified by the token below.

session token of tajog-fahaf = htk21_4ae55819f45410afcb307